At least 7 dead in Georgia dock collapse on US Atlantic coast


  • World
  • Sunday, 20 Oct 2024

ATLANTA (Reuters) -At least seven people were killed after part of a boat dock collapsed, sending at least 20 into the Atlantic waters off the coast of the U.S. state of Georgia.

U.S. Coast Guard ships were searching on Saturday night for missing people.
